5. An invoice for $3,290, dated April 26th, covering merchandise received May19th, carries terms of 8/10 EOM, ROG. It is paid on June 10. (pretend that all months have 30 days, for simplicity)
(a.) How much should have been remitted? Answer: $3,026.80
6.Goods that are invoiced on July 26 are received on August 10. Indicate the final discount date for net payment and the final date for net payment if terms are: (pretend that all months have 30 days, for simplicity)
Answers:
Final Discount Date,Net Payment Date
(a.) 3/10 EOM=Sept. 10,Sept. 30
(b.) 2/10, net 30=Aug. 6,Aug. 26
(c.) 1/20-30X=Sept. 16,Oct. 6
(d.) 8/10 EOM as of Sept. 1=Oct. 10,Oct. 30
(e.) 8/10 EOM, ROG=Sept. 10,Sept. 30
